Can Justin Jefferson Rebound with New QB?

Two-time All-Pro wide receiver Justin Jefferson is coming off the worst season of his career, his sixth with the Minnesota Vikings. Following a season of uninspired quarterback play from J.J. McCarthy, Carson Wentz, and Max Brosmer, which led to career lows for Jefferson in terms of receiving yards and touchdowns, the team made a splash on Thursday by agreeing to a one-year deal with former first overall pick Kyler Murray. While Murray has never topped 4,000 passing yards in a season and has a spotty track record of supporting number one receivers, if he can reach anything approaching league-average quarterback play, Jefferson can thrive. A 31.4% target share in 2025 kept Jefferson afloat with some of the worst quarterback play in the league, while his lifetime average of 9.27 targets per game is a top-10 all-time number and one that Murray would be wise to continue bumping up if he wants to hit 2027 free agency on a high note.

Ja'Marr Chase Has Overall WR1 Upside with Quarterback Healthy

Cincinnati Bengals wide receiver Ja'Marr Chase continued to produce at a high level in 2025. Even with inconsistent quarterback play, Chase caught 125 passes for 1,412 yards and eight touchdowns over 16 games, ranking as the WR4 in PPR leagues. He didn't replicate his overall WR1 finish from 2024, but he still offered top-tier results for his fantasy managers down the stretch. Most importantly, Chase didn't let quarterback issues alter his productivity too much. Sure, he looked much better when Joe Burrow was healthy, but he still ranked as a WR1 when catching passes from Jake Browning and Joe Flacco. With Burrow entering the offseason on a clean bill of health, Chase finds himself back in the high-end WR1 tier. In fact, he has the potential to rank as the overall WR1 as long as Burrow stays healthy for most or all of the 2026 campaign. The LSU product has been a top-12 fantasy receiver in all five of his pro campaigns, as well as a top-five receiver in three of the five. He remains a hot commodity in the first round of redraft leagues going forward, and he's (justifiably) one of the most expensive trade targets in dynasty formats.
